Channeling the emotions of the open road and joys of exploring new destinations, Riot Ten teams up with Charly Jordan on the effervescent track “Wanna Go.” It leads off Riot Ten‘s BLKMRKT project, which sees the bass producer take a deep foray into the world of house music.

This new collaboration is a testament to the versatility and creativity of the two producers, as they deliver breezy summertime vibes and infectious vocal melodies. Riot Ten‘s heavy-hitting dubstep from his “Hype or Die” releases is nowhere to be found. Instead, the Texas-born producer continues to experiment with the house sounds he established earlier this year on “Lost Your Mind.” “Wanna Go” also serves as the second single ever from social media influencer and rising DJ/producer Charly Jordan. A few months ago, she officially entered the music industry via “Blackstrap Molasses,” which harmoniously fused pop and dance music. Born and raised in El PasoTXRiot Ten exploded into the world of EDM at the young age of 22. Joining the Dim Mak Records family in 2017, with additional music out on Never Say DieInsomniacBassrush and Excision‘s “Rottun Records“, Riot Ten blasted off with four #1top 100 dubstep singles and his music can be heard around the world from the likes of DJ SnakeZeds DeadThe ChainsmokersExcision and many more. The 2017 single “Fuck It” became a staple on The Chainsmokers‘ “Memories Do Not Open” tour. This success helped pave the way for “Rail Breaker“, his global smash in 2017, to become one of the most played out dubstep songs of the last decade. The single continues to see support at nearly every major festival from the biggest names in dance music. Following the release of “Rail Breaker“, Riot Ten dropped his debut EP with Dim Mak called “Hype Or Die: The Dead” in 2018, which recorded a top 10 debut on the iTunes dance album charts, a feat seldom seen by an artist in the genre. He recorded another top 10 debut on the iTunes charts in 2019 with his debut album “Hype Or Die: Nightmares.” Outside of the music, Riot Ten has continued to record sell-out shows domestically and internationally, touring the infamous “Hype Or Die” brand for its 2nd straight year. He has also played EDC Las VegasCoachellaNocturnal WonderlandElectric ZooEDC MexicoLost LandsEDC OrlandoGlobal Dance FestivalElectric ForestBass CanyonImagine Music Festival and more.

American born female artist Charly Jordan brings her creative direction into house music, with her unique travel background and cultural accents felt through her style. Charly was born and raised in Las VegasNevada, where she was surrounded by some of the best entertainment and music in the world. Growing up, she pursued a career in track and field, which later flipped into a successful modeling/ creative directing career, collectively gaining around 3 million followers across social media platforms at just 21 years old. Now stepping into singing and songwriting on her own tracks, after years of traveling around the world, her unique taste is a culmination of different house styles. With her first single now out “Blackstrap Molasses,” more can be expected from this new, young artist.

PAUZA takes the second release on FLAMENCA Records with a Afro-Cuban House edit of STBAN and Sandra Carrasco’s ‘Plaza de Gloria’.

As spring turns to summer and global dance floors heat up, FLAMENCA Records drops their second release, PAUZA’s scorching Afro-Cuban House edit of the STBAN and Sandra Carrasco production ‘Plaza de Gloria’.

Rooted in traditional flamenco and forming part of STBAN’s live show FLAMENCA, PAUZA reimagine ‘Plaza de Gloria’ with a remix that blends Cuban tradition with Andalusian folklore, celebrating the original’s brass, percussion and Spanish guitar, the latter provided by influential guitarist, composer and Ketama member Josemi Carmona. The haunting topline from critically acclaimed, award winning flamenco singer Sandra Carrasco weaves in and out of the composition, floating high above syncopated claps before thrusting back down deep inside reverberating house rhythms and hypnotic, undulating basslines. The combination makes it an instant, sultry addition to any DJ set and underlines why FLAMENCA Records boss STBAN invited PAUZA onto the label.

Hailing from Havana, Cuban duo PAUZA – Paula ‘Pau’ Fernandez and Zahira ‘Zahi’ Sanchez – were always going to be a natural fit for STBAN’s FLAMENCA project. Leaning into a similar ideology of sharing the traditional music and folkloric styles of their homeland through modern electronica, the pair have been critically acclaimed by the likes of Rolling Stone, LA Times, NYLON, Vice and DJ Mag LATAM. Infusing their work with Latin rhythms and Cuban sentiments the duo, Cuba’s first female DJ pairing, see their music as a natural and vibrant extension of the lifestyle they live every day on the island.

In this new version, Yoruba drums and Afro-Cuban rhythms intertwine with southern Spanish palmas, cajón, and melodies — creating a sonic dialogue between two cultures rooted in heritage, rhythm, and resistance,” the duo explained. “Deep percussion and electronic elements bridge Havana and Spain in a remix that honors spirituality, feminine strength, and the powerful folk legacy that inspired the original track.

The track is accompanied by a video shot on location in the streets of Seville, another nod to flamenco’s heritage from STBAN after his Marrakech video for previous single ‘La Palma‘. “The song ‘Plaza de Gloria’ is all about personal transformation,” the FLAMENCA boss said, “and so in the video we show a woman who throws off what no longer serves her and instead follows her heart, reconnecting with herself through culture, movement and community. The Feria – or the carnival – becomes a space of emotional release, through our rhythms and traditions. You can feel her find the joy, the freedom, the confidence to reclaim her identity on her own terms. It’s a true celebration of becoming, of dancing like nobody’s watching, of becoming her own Plaza de Gloria.

Jude & Frank drop scorching 2025 rework of Latin hit ‘Candela’ ft. Spanish-language sensation Noelia

Latin house trailblazer Jude & Frank returns with a scorching 2025 rework of the legendary Latin hit ‘Candela’, featuring the unmistakable voice of Noelia, the global pop-dance icon and Spanish-language sensation with over 2.5 million monthly Spotify listeners.

Infused with Jude & Frank’s signature Latin house groove, booming basslines, and floor-shaking percussion, this fresh reimagining of ‘Candela’ is built for clubs, beach parties, and festival stages alike. Enhanced by Noelia’s legendary vocals, the track masterfully bridges rich Latin heritage with the electrifying pulse of modern house music.

Jude & Frank, born and raised in Rome, has carved a name as one of the leading forces in the international Latin and tech house scene. With hit records like ‘La Luna’, ‘La Candela Viva’ (with HUGEL), ‘Sun Is Shining’ (official Bob Marley rework), and ‘La Tarde’, Jude & Frank has released on industry giants such as Spinnin’ Records, Armada Music, Insomniac Records US, and Sony Music. His tracks have earned support from global tastemakers including Pete Tong, David Guetta, Martin Garrix, Claptone, Afrojack, and Bob Sinclar.

The success of ‘La Luna’, which reached #1 on the Beatport Overall Chart and garnered over 15 million Spotify streams, was crowned by a spin on BBC Radio 1’s Essential Selection.

Joining on ‘Candela (2025)’ is Noelia, the Puerto Rican-born, Miami-raised singer-songwriter who became a breakout star in 1999. Her self-titled debut went Gold in the U.S., leading to an illustrious career that includes 10 Billboard Latin Top 40 hits, 5 Billboard Club Dance Top 40s, 18 Gold and 9 multi-Platinum certifications globally, as well as an RIAA Gold-certified record.

Together, Jude & Frank and Noelia release ‘Candela (2025)’, a fiery summer anthem ready to set dancefloors ablaze.

Joe T Vannelli, the renowned international DJ and producer, has released his latest single ‘Sensation’ via his label Dream Beat Rec.

Joe T Vannelli delivers this dynamic house track in two compelling versions, Club and Melodic House, featuring the unforgettable voice of legendary American disco and soul diva Loleatta Holloway.

‘Sensation’ masterfully blends contemporary house grooves with classic influences, delivering a rhythmic intensity and vibrant vocal energy designed to captivate dancefloors worldwide. Whether powering up the peak of high-energy clubs or enriching deep, immersive sets, this single is crafted to resonate with diverse audiences.

Joe T Vannelli reflects on the project: “I had the pleasure of remixing this magical voice a few years ago for Ultra Records, and today I was once again inspired by Miss Loleatta. I wanted to add a musical power that gives you goosebumps.”

With a career spanning over four decades, Joe T Vannelli is a pivotal figure in the global House music scene. He has performed at prestigious venues such as Ibiza’s Pacha and Amnesia, Mykonos’ Cavo Paradiso, New York’s Marquee, and Berlin’s Love Parade, among others. His production credits include platinum hits like Robert Miles‘Children’, Pink Floyd’s ‘Another Brick in the Wall’ remix, and Spiller’s ‘Groovejet’. Joe has collaborated with iconic artists like Giorgio Moroder, Eartha Kitt, and Thelma Houston.

Joe’s innovative spirit continues with his Milan-based creative hub SoundFaktory, supporting new talent and live music production. His recent streaming project during the pandemic amassed over 15 million views, showcasing his commitment to music and connection.

With a social following exceeding 500,000 fans, Joe T Vannelli remains a trusted and influential figure in the dance music industry, continually delivering sounds that define the moment.
